2. Check Water Consumption



Evaluate your water costs as well as track your water usage. As the one paying it, you need to see if there are any type of discrepancies. If you spot sudden changes, regardless of your usage being the same, it suggests that you have leaks in your plumbing system. Keep in mind, your water costs need to fall under the same range monthly. An unexpected spike in your bill shows a fast-moving leak.

A steady rise every month, even with the very same routines, shows you have a slow-moving leak that's likewise slowly intensifying. Call a plumber to thoroughly examine your building, particularly if you feel a warm location on your flooring with piping below.

4. Asses Exterior Lines



Don't fail to remember to examine your outside water lines also. Test spigots by connecting a yard pipe. Ought to water leak out of the connection, you have a loose rubber gasket. Replace this and guarantee all links are limited. If you've got an automatic sprinkler, it will certainly aid get it skillfully analyzed and also preserved each year. One small leak can lose tons of water as well as surge your water costs.

WARNING SIGNS OF WATER LEAKAGE BEHIND THE WALL


PERSISTENT MUSTY ODORS


As water slowly drips from a leaky pipe inside the wall, flooring and sheetrock stay damp and develop an odor similar to wet cardboard. It generates a musty smell that can help you find hidden leaks.




MOLD IN UNUSUAL AREAS


Mold usually grows in wet areas like kitchens, baths and laundry rooms. If you spot the stuff on walls or baseboards in other rooms of the house, it’s a good indicator of undetected water leaks.




STAINS THAT GROW


When mold thrives around a leaky pipe, it sometimes takes hold on the inside surface of the affected wall. A growing stain on otherwise clean sheetrock is often your sign of a hidden plumbing problem.




PEELING OR BUBBLING WALLPAPER / PAINT


This clue is easy to miss in rooms that don’t get much use. When you see wallpaper separating along seams or paint bubbling or flaking off the wall, blame sheetrock that stays wet because of an undetected leak.




BUCKLED CEILINGS AND STAINED FLOORS


If ceilings or floors in bathrooms, kitchens or laundry areas develop structural problems, don’t rule out constant damp inside the walls. Wet sheetrock can affect adjacent framing, flooring and ceilings.
